Web7 mrt. 2024 · Employee A’s Bradford Factor score is 288 which is calculated by: S x S x D = Bradford Factor 6 x 6 x 8 = 288 Employee B Over the last 12 months, Employee B has been absent from work on 2 occasions due to sickness. These 2 occasions account for 16 days of absence in total over the 12 month period.
